Heart-Healthy Poha

Wholesome, vibrant, and packed with nutrients, Heart-Healthy Poha is a quick and delicious breakfast or snack option that's perfect for those looking to prioritize cardiovascular wellness. This guilt-free recipe swaps traditional cooking oils for nutrient-rich olive oil and incorporates colorful, antioxidant-packed vegetables like carrots, green peas, and red bell peppers for a flavorful twist. Seasoned with aromatic spices like mustard seeds, cumin, and turmeric, this Indian-inspired delight is finished with a refreshing squeeze of lemon juice and a sprinkle of fresh cilantro for a zesty, herby finish. Ready in just 25 minutes and naturally gluten-free, this light yet satisfying dish is a must-try for health-conscious foodies.

Prep Time:10 mins
Cook Time:15 mins
Total Time:25 mins
Servings: 4

Ingredients

  • 200 grams poha (flattened rice)
  • 1 tablespoon olive oil
  • 1 teaspoon mustard seeds
  • 1 teaspoon cumin seeds
  • 8 leaves curry leaves
  • 1 medium green chili
  • 1 medium onion
  • 0.5 teaspoon turmeric powder
  • 0.5 teaspoon salt
  • 1 medium carrot
  • 0.5 cup green peas
  • 1 medium red bell pepper
  • 2 tablespoons lemon juice
  • 2 tablespoons fresh cilantro

Directions

Step 1

Rinse the poha in a colander under running water until it softens. Set it aside to drain completely.

Step 2

Heat the olive oil in a large non-stick pan over medium heat.

Step 3

Add the mustard seeds and cumin seeds to the hot oil. When they begin to splutter, add the curry leaves and green chili, sliced thinly.

Step 4

Add the onion, finely chopped, and sauté until it turns translucent, about 3 minutes.

Step 5

Stir in the turmeric powder and salt, followed by the diced carrot, green peas, and red bell pepper. Cook for about 5-7 minutes, stirring occasionally.

Step 6

Once the vegetables are tender, add the drained poha to the pan. Gently mix everything together and cook for another 2-3 minutes.

Step 7

Turn off the heat and mix in the lemon juice.

Step 8

Garnish with chopped fresh cilantro before serving.
